Off road GPS maps are ideal for rough trips
The original GPS satellites comprised of a military application which was used to locate the positions of anything or anyone worldwide. Around a decade ago GPS’s have been adapted for commercial use, and can be pluged into your off road 4×4 which allows you to go where ever without getting lost. To help you navigate your way through tough off road terrains in Australia when getting out there on off the beaten track fun it is important to make sure you have up to date maps. You can download all the latest up to date maps off the internet by searching for 4×4 off road Australian maps.
You need to bear in mind that the standard map directories on your cell phone do not always have the latest updates as new roads get built and the landscapes you are travelling may not be available and the 4X4 off road gps maps Australia will ensure you do not get lost. Once you have all your up dated maps in place and you are certain that you will get from one place to the next, you need to prepare for your 4×4 journey. In order to explore the vastness of Australia safely you need to have a great spirit of adventure and a sense of humour. Make certain that you have rope, plenty of food and water, extra fuel and a shovel and in case your phone does not pick up reception you should bring along a two way radio. Also bear in mind that Australia is not altogether tropical and that the desert in the evenings can become exceptionally cold as temperatures can drop below minus 5 degree Celsius and in other parts of Australia you will experience extreme heat and humidity.
